The Growth of Online Education

One of the most significant advancements in digital learning has been the rapid growth of online education. Online courses, also known as e-learning, offer students the ability to study at their own pace from anywhere in the world. Platforms like Coursera, edX, and Udemy provide access to a wide range of courses, from academic subjects like mathematics and history to professional development and skills training in areas like coding, marketing, and design.

Online education has become particularly popular for those looking to further their education while balancing work or personal commitments. The flexibility of learning from home allows students to tailor their schedules to fit their lifestyle. Additionally, many online platforms offer courses from top universities and institutions, making high-quality education more accessible than ever before.

Virtual Classrooms and Collaborative Learning

Virtual classrooms have become an essential aspect of digital learning, particularly in the wake of the COVID-19 pandemic. Schools, universities, and training institutions around the world quickly adopted virtual classroom technology to maintain continuity in education as physical classrooms were closed. Platforms such as Zoom, Microsoft Teams, and Google Meet have enabled real-time video lessons, discussions, and group activities.

These virtual environments provide opportunities for students and educators to engage with one another regardless of location. Students can participate in live lectures, ask questions, collaborate with peers in breakout rooms, and access shared resources like presentations and assignments. Virtual classrooms have made it possible for teachers to offer personalized attention to students, providing a more interactive and flexible learning experience.

Moreover, virtual classrooms foster collaborative learning by breaking down geographical barriers. Students from different parts of the world can come together in a single virtual space to work on projects, share ideas, and learn from one another. This global exchange of knowledge enriches the learning experience and helps students develop skills that are valuable in a globalized workforce.

Interactive Learning Tools and Gamification

Incorporating interactive learning tools is another powerful aspect of digital learning. Technologies like educational apps, simulations, and virtual reality (VR) have transformed the way students engage with content. Instead of passively listening to a lecture or reading a textbook, students can now interact with educational materials in a hands-on, immersive way.

For example, apps like Khan Academy, Duolingo, and Quizlet use interactive quizzes, games, and exercises to help students learn new concepts while keeping them engaged. Gamification, or the use of game-like elements in learning, has become a popular method to increase student motivation and retention. Students earn rewards, badges, or points for completing lessons or achieving milestones, making learning more enjoyable and competitive.

Moreover, virtual and augmented reality (VR/AR) technologies are making it possible to simulate real-world experiences that would be difficult or impossible to recreate in a traditional classroom. For instance, medical students can use VR to practice surgeries or anatomy dissections, while history students can explore ancient civilizations through virtual tours. These interactive experiences enhance student engagement and help them retain knowledge more effectively.

Personalized Learning with Artificial Intelligence

Artificial intelligence (AI) is revolutionizing digital learning by enabling personalized education. AI-powered platforms can analyze a student’s performance, identify areas of strength and weakness, and adapt the content accordingly. This tailored approach allows students to learn at their own pace, focusing more on the topics they struggle with and advancing more quickly through areas they grasp easily.

Platforms like DreamBox, Squirrel AI, and Knewton utilize AI algorithms to deliver personalized lessons and feedback to students, providing real-time insights into their learning journey. These tools help educators track student progress, adjust teaching methods, and offer additional support where needed.

AI is also being used to provide virtual tutoring, enabling students to receive instant help with homework or understanding complex concepts. This makes learning more accessible and efficient, especially for students who may need extra help but cannot always access a tutor in person.

Overcoming Barriers to Access in Education

Digital learning has the potential to bridge educational gaps by providing access to quality resources, even in remote or underserved regions. Many students around the world face barriers to education, such as limited access to textbooks, qualified teachers, or schools in their local area. Digital learning platforms help overcome these obstacles by offering free or low-cost resources that can be accessed from anywhere with an internet connection.

For example, initiatives like the One Laptop per Child project and Khan Academy’s free courses have provided millions of students in developing countries with access to educational content that they would not otherwise have had. By using mobile phones, laptops, and community internet centers, students can now access a wealth of knowledge that helps them develop skills and improve their futures.

While access to the internet remains a challenge in some areas, the growth of mobile technology and affordable data plans continues to make digital learning more accessible. As infrastructure improves and digital resources become more widespread, digital learning has the potential to democratize education globally.

Challenges and Future of Digital Learning

Despite its many benefits, digital learning does come with its own set of challenges. One major concern is the digital divide, where students in low-income or rural areas may not have reliable internet access or the necessary devices to participate fully in online learning. Additionally, some students may struggle with self-motivation in a virtual environment, especially without the structure of a traditional classroom.

Furthermore, the shift to digital learning raises concerns about data privacy and security. As more students and educators use online platforms, ensuring the protection of personal data becomes a priority for institutions and tech companies.

Looking forward, the future of digital learning is bright. With continued advancements in AI, VR, and other emerging technologies, digital learning will become even more immersive, interactive, and accessible. As educational institutions continue to embrace digital tools, we can expect a more personalized, flexible, and inclusive approach to learning, where students can thrive in a rapidly changing world.
